Coldplay will not release a new album this year

I know some of you can’t go very long without some type of Coldplay fix, be it new music or a live performance, but I’m sorry to say that you guys won’t be getting a new LP this year. I hear it’s because Chris Martin hates all of you.



Well, ok, that might be the reason. But we do know, thanks to the website Coldplaying.com, that Martin did meet up with some fans in old Londontown. Website member Craigy-J posted “There ain’t gonna be a release for Christmas now that is for sure. Chris (Martin) said that although they are close to finishing lots of songs, they have not actually finished anything at all yet… (even Wedding Bells!) and he said there’d be no chance of the album coming out for Christmas.”

Their former manager, Phil Harvey, confirmed to Billboard that the time between the new release and it’s tour would be “slightly longer” than usual. So, for those that need their Coldplay smack, you can watch Martin play “Wedding Bells” at the Apple Keynote Address on a loop until your eyes bug out.
